Ethernet Cables: The Unwavering Conduit
Ethernet cables, with their physical presence, serve as unwavering conduits of data transmission. They establish a direct, stable connection between a device and a router, guaranteeing reliable performance and blazing-fast speeds. Unlike their wireless counterparts, ethernet cables are immune to interference, ensuring a consistent and uninterrupted browsing experience.
Wi-Fi Extenders: The Spectral Gateway
Wi-Fi extenders, on the other hand, operate on a different plane of existence. Employing the spectral domain, they amplify existing Wi-Fi signals, expanding their reach to zones where the primary connection falters. However, this wireless bridge comes with inherent trade-offs: reduced speeds, potential interference, and the introduction of additional latency.
Deciphering the Matrix of Connectivity
Choosing the right solution ultimately boils down to understanding the nuances of each technology and matching it to specific requirements. When seeking the utmost reliability and speed, ethernet cables reign supreme. For bridging connectivity gaps in large or complex spaces, Wi-Fi extenders offer a viable solution, albeit with limitations.
Ethernet Cables: Ideal for:
High-performance gaming and streaming
Enterprise-level applications
Stable and reliable connections
Areas with minimal Wi-Fi interference
Wi-Fi Extenders: Ideal for:
Extending coverage to remote areas
Improving connectivity in multi-story or large buildings
Addressing pockets of poor Wi-Fi reception
Temporary or mobile setup situations
